Canary gating for the Brightmoor platform: a canary may advance only when error rate stays under 0.5% for 30 minutes, p99 latency is within 10% of baseline, and no open sev-2 incidents exist. Overrides require two approvals and are logged for review. Canary manifests are signed before admission; the gate verifies them against the key below.

deploy key for kahof-tadup: bky4_rRMZ

Subject: DR drill — FlagPilot rollout framework

Reviewer,

DR drill for FlagPilot is Thursday. Scope: restore the flag-state store from cold backup, replay rollout events, verify kill-switch behavior. Your part: review the restore script PR before Wednesday noon. Note the restore step prompts for the vault unlock — don't stub it out like last time; the drill validates the real path. Keep the run under 20 minutes. The prompt expects the recovery passphrase, which appears immediately below.

strongbox words: norwyn-wenael-aldvan-aldiel-wendor-holael

Handover Note — Directors Varga to Ellsmere, re: Pellwick Term Sheet. Branch managers: Pellwick Cooperative has issued a revised term sheet for the distribution partnership. Key changes: three-year exclusivity in the northern territories, volume commitments up 12%, and a co-marketing fund. Legal review is underway; Ellsmere takes ownership of negotiations from Monday. Do not reference the terms in customer conversations until the agreement is signed. The strategic considerations driving our position are summarised in the note below.

management briefing: Project Ulavan slips by two quarters because of the staffing delay.